The 2025 Mid-America Trucking Show is well underway, with plenty for attendees to take in, both on the show floor and out in the parking lot where the PKY Truck Beauty Championship takes place.

Dozens of trucks lined up and shined up, looking to impress judges ahead of the PKY awards ceremony taking place Saturday morning.

See a small sampling of the dozens of trucks participating in the 2025 PKY Truck Beauty Championship below:

John Treadway's 1998 Peterbilt 379John Treadway's 1998 Peterbilt 379 is painted to match his Harley-Davidson motorcycle.

Brandon Smith's 2024 Peterbilt 389Raleigh, North Carolina-based Brandon Smith's 2024 Peterbilt 389

Gary Jones' 1979 Peterbilt 359SPB Trucking owner Gary Jones went away from his traditional big-bunk show trucks and brought this 1979 Peterbilt 359 day cab that he recently built.

Greg Graham's 1979 Peterbilt 359Greg Graham built this 1979 Peterbilt 359 in honor of his late fiancee, Betsy Romero, who passed away from breast cancer.

Rick and Lisa Weddle's 2006 Peterbilt 379Rick and Lisa Weddle own this 2006 Peterbilt 379, which sits on a 305-inch wheelbase.
